Tintra: Continues fundraising round with a further $10 million investment

  • Tintra PLC, continues its fundraising round having received a further $10 million in investment
  • On a mission to solve the challenges faced across emerging markets using a ground-up approach
  • Setting out to truly understand the cultural dissonance that drives inequality for unbanked
  • As such, this latest investment round will help fund the development of its revolutionary banking infrastructure
  • Technology that is, at its core, designed to establish someone’s financial innocence and not purely out to prosecute those who are guilty
  • This news closely follows an update issued by the PLC in December 2022 on its current funding round
